Fresh, flavorful vegetables straight from your homegrown haven — that's the dream! And with a little know-how, you can make it a reality.

Vegetable gardening may seem daunting at first, but starting is easier than you think. Prepare to transform your outdoor space into a thriving edible paradise with these simple tips.

First, choose a spot that gets plenty of sunshine – most vegetables need at least six hours of direct sunlight per day. Then, collect the necessary tools: a good gardening spade, some garden gloves, and sprinkler.

Next, it's time to choose your vegetables! Consider what you enjoy eating most and what thrives in your climate. For beginners, easy-to-grow options like tomatoes, lettuce, peppers, and radishes are always a good bet.

Once your garden beds are ready, it's time to plant! Follow the instructions on the seed packets or plant tags carefully, making sure to space them appropriately for abundant yields.

And finally, don't forget about watering! Keep your soil consistently moist but not soggy. Regular moisture maintenance is essential for your vegetables to flourish.

Jump Start! Simple Steps for Starting a Vegetable Garden

Want to taste the freshest veggies? Starting your own vegetable garden is easier than you believe.

Here are some simple steps to get started:

* Select a sunny spot in your yard.

* Prepare the area by removing any weeds or debris.

* Loosen the soil to about a foot.

* Improve the soil with compost.

* Pick your favorite plants based on your climate.

* Sow your seeds or seedlings according to their guidance.

* Water your garden regularly, especially during hot weather.

Gather Happiness: Your First Steps in Homegrown Vegetables

Dreaming of delicious tomatoes bursting with flavor and crisp lettuce grown in your own backyard? Starting a home vegetable garden can be an immensely joyous experience. It's a chance to connect with nature, savor the freshest produce, and maybe even impress your neighbors with your culinary skills! Launch your gardening journey with these simple steps:

  • Choose a sunny area in your yard that receives at least six hours of sunlight daily.
  • Amend your soil by adding compost or other organic matter to improve its texture and fertility.
  • Sow seeds or seedlings directly into the ground, following the instructions on the seed packet.
  • Water your plants regularly, keeping the soil moist but not waterlogged.
  • Monitor your garden for pests or diseases and take action promptly if necessary.

With a little patience, you'll be harvesting the fruits (and vegetables!) of your labor in no time. Enjoy the flavor!
